The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Joseph Searle, born in 1835 in Aylesbury, Buckinghamshire, consisted of 5 members. Joseph was the head of the household, married to Catherine Searle, born in 1834 in Leighton Buzzard, Bedfordshire, England. They had 2 children; Frederick (born 1866 in Lambeth, Surrey, England) and Jane (born 1863 in Lambeth, Surrey, England).
During the period, also present in the household was Joseph's Nephew, Joseph Gibbons, born in 1863 in Leighton Buzzard, Bedfordshire, England.
